Web22 mrt. 2024 · How long do you cook a whole chicken? - Roast a 4.5 to 5.5 lb. whole chicken at 425 degrees Fahrenheit for 1 hour, 15 minutes. A 6 to 6.5 lb. whole chicken will take 1 hour and 30 minutes at 425. - Your chicken should reach an internal temperature of 160 before you remove it from the oven.
